PC is not detecting my scansa C250V2. -error- Refresh data base

My scansa C250V2 is not working. -error showing as - Refresh data base. even when I try to coneect to a PC it is not recognizing - Please advice me.

I had the exact same problem, and i found the solution! if everything he didnt said still doesnt work (though id suggest doing all of it to be sure) unplug your Fuze from your computer and go to "settings." then click "system settings" and scroll down to "USB mode." choose either MTP or MSP. your computer should recognize one of these.

What i would recommend you to do is to uninstall the device and reinstall it back...to uninstall it...assuming that you are running windows xp...click on start, right click on my computer and go to properties..you should have your system properties open then click under hardware then device manager...look for the sansa device..it usually located under portable device..if its not showing there i would recommend you to look for under disk drives and see if its there..right click on the device and click on uninstall...after you unintall it unplug your device from the computer....Then follow this link below to download the porting kit...http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/details.aspx?FamilyId=A2E73160-E862-4F19-BB26-C0CAFE798955&displaylang=en .Then check the mode of yuor device to make sure it sunder MTP not msc...To check the mode go under menu, settings and choose usb mode...After you check the mode open up your windows media player click on tools, options and click under privacy...clear the history and caches...after you finish you can plug the device on the back of the computer not the front then windows should recongnize it and it should work properly..if that doesnt solve the problems upgrade your windows media player to 11 even though you have done that already..and try to reconnect your device..make sure you have it connected on the back USB>>>

And if that doesnt work try to obtain the driver for your sandisk device go to http://www.sandisk.com/DriverDownload/index.asp and find the driver for your device..and then connecct the device on the back of your computer...it should work properly..if you are still having any problems..let me know..i would be more than happy to assist you..

Dell m90 beeping codes

Dell BIOS Beep Codes: Beep Codes Possible Causes Corrective Action 1 - 2 No video card detected Reseat the video card 1 - 2 - 2 - 3 BIOS ROM checksum error 1 - 3 - 1 - 1 DRAM refresh error Reseat the memory modules 1 - 3 - 1 - 3 8742 Keyboard Controller error Reseat the keyboard connector 1 - 3 - 3 - 1 Memory defective or not present Reseat the memory modules 1 - 3 - 4 - 1 RAM failure on line xxx Reseat the memory modules 1 - 3 - 4 - 3 RAM failure on data bits xxx of low byte on memory bus Reseat the memory modules 1 - 4 - 1 - 1 RAM failure on data bits xxx of high byte on memory bus Reseat the memory modules

I unplugged my USB before it was finished ejecting, and now when i plug it in neither my mac nor my PC recognize it, as in in it doesn't light up or even register that it's plugged in at all. It's as...

There are several reason why your flash drive is not working. You can try this and see if it will work:
STEP 1 - Connect the Cruzer to the PC

If you receive a "USB Device Not Recognized" error on the computer, the flash drive is most likely failed. Additional troubleshooting is unlikely to correct the problem.
id10_not-detected.gif


STEP 2 - Check under Device Manager
1. Right-click My Computer, and select Manage.
id107-1.gif

2. Click Device Manager on the left pane.
id10-2-3.gif

NOTE: The Cruzer might show up under several places under Device Manager such as:
1. Disk Drives
2. DVD/CD-ROM drives
3. Universal Serial Bus controls as USB Mass Storage.

If there is a yellow exclamation point (!) or question mark (?) beside the device, try to refresh the drivers.
id10-2-note.gif


STEP 3 - Refresh the drivers
1. Right-click on the entry with the error mark, select Uninstall.
id10-2-4.gif

2. On the top menu, click Action then select Scan for hardware changes.
id10-3-2.gif


STEP 4 - Verify if the flash drive is detected
1. Double-click My Computer.
2. Look for the Cruzer under devices with removable storage.

Music in music library shows corrupted cannot delete

Connect ur phone to ur PC in Data transfer mode.
Make sure u can view hidden files in ur pc.
Open E:\private\
where E: is ur memory card drive name
Delete all the files in "private" folder.(u can copy and save all the files before deleting incase anything goes
Disconnect ur phone and restart it.
Open music library it will refresh itself automatically.
Mines working fine now....

Sansa e200 shows refresh database fail

try putting it in MSC mode and formating it and then putting back on MTP mode. Hope that works
